What does a sewer camera inspection actually show, and do I really need one?
A sewer camera travels through the drain line and transmits live video, revealing blockages, root intrusion, pipe bellies, cracks, and offset joints that a snake alone can't diagnose. If you have recurring clogs or slow drains that don't respond to standard clearing, a camera inspection tells you exactly what's happening and where - so the repair targets the real problem instead of guessing.
Can drain cleaning get rid of tree roots that keep coming back in my sewer line?
Tree roots enter sewer laterals through hairline cracks at pipe joints, then expand as they absorb moisture. A cable auger cuts through the roots and restores flow, but roots regrow. Hydro jetting follows up by scouring the pipe wall clean, removing root debris and slowing regrowth. A sewer camera inspection after the job confirms the line is clear and identifies any joint damage that may need repair.
My kitchen drain keeps clogging a few weeks after I clear it myself - why does it keep coming back?
Cooking grease cools and solidifies on the pipe wall in layers. A hand auger punches through the clog but leaves the grease coating behind, so buildup rebuilds quickly. Roto-Rooter's hydro jetting uses high-pressure water jets to scour the pipe wall, removing calcified grease and food solids that a cable can't cut. The result lasts significantly longer than a basic snaking.
What's causing my bathroom tub, sink, and toilet to all back up at the same time?
When multiple fixtures back up simultaneously, the blockage is almost always in the main sewer line rather than an individual drain. Hair and soap scum in one fixture wouldn't affect the others. A Roto-Rooter technician uses a sewer camera to pinpoint the exact location - roots, a collapsed section, or a deep clog - then clears it with an auger or hydro jetting.
